2012 Ford taurus sho performance parts Source Source Source Source Source Source Source Source Source Source Read Also: Ford taurus sho 0-60 performance 2012 Ford taurus performance parts 1994 Ford taurus performance parts 2012 Ford sho performance parts 97 Ford taurus sho performance parts Ford taurus x performance parts